Segítsetek, mert már beleőrülök

Hali,

Segítségetek kellene, mert beleőrülök hogy nem tudok rájönni arra hogyan kell beszúrni html-be font-ot, úgy hogy ez egy nem elterjedt font, hanem mondjuk (tételezzük fel) csak nekem van ilyen és szeretném ha Ti is ebben a formában látnátok. Tehát olyan megoldás érdekel ami nem flash és lehetőség szerint nem kép.

Köszi :)

Hozzászólások

@font-face {
  font-family:"MyCustomFont";
  src:url(MyCustomFont.ttf) format("truetype");
}

Röviden: Sehogy.
Ha teljesen egyedi fontot szeretnél használni az oldaladon, akkor vagy felajánlod az oldal látogatóinak, hogy töltsék le (amit nem fognak), vagy kép formátumban teszed fel a tartalmat.

--
"Maradt még 2 kB-om. Teszek bele egy TCP-IP stacket és egy bootlogót. "

Megnéztem, legeneráltattam, a scriptet letöltöttem és beillesztettem html-be, majd a css body részébe family-font: chiller ként beillesztettem, de nem megy :( lehet ténylegt kép lesz a megoldás vagy valami általános betűtípus. Amúgy firefox 3.0-val próbáltam. Köszönöm a segítségeket.

http://www.tranceislands.hu
http://georgemichael.weboldala.net

Megnéztem, legeneráltattam, a scriptet letöltöttem és beillesztettem html-be, majd a css body részébe family-font: chiller ként beillesztettem, de nem megy :(

Nem igazán értem, hogy mit csináltál family-font chillerrel, mert a css-t nem kell piszkálni. Itt egy útmutató:

1. Fogod a Chiller.ttf fájlt, legenerálod az online generátorral, kapsz egy Chiller_400.font.js nevű fájlt.
2. Leszeded magának a Cufónak a scriptjét.
3. Beleilleszted mind a betű scriptet, mind a Cufó scriptet az oldal headjébe külső javascriptként:

<script type="text/javascript" src="cufon-yui.js"></script>
<script type="text/javascript" src="Chiller_400.font.js"></script>

4. Meghívod (szintén a headben) a Cufon funkciót azokkal a html elemekkel, amiket a Chiller betűtípusként akarsz látni, pl.:

<script type="text/javascript">
Cufon('h1')('h2');
</script>

Ennyi. Ennek működnie kell, most próbáltam ki, az oldalamra fel is raktam egy mintát.

Nálam Windowson és Linuxon is hibátlan:

Debian Lenny:
Mozilla/5.0 (X11; U; Linux x86_64; hu-HU; rv:1.9.0.9) Gecko/2009050519 Iceweasel/3.0.6 (Debian-3.0.6-1)

Windows XP:
Mozilla/5.0 (Windows; U; Windows NT 5.1; hu; rv:1.9.0.10) Gecko/2009042316 Firefox/3.0.10
Internet Explorer 6: Verziószám: 6.0.2900.5512.xpsp_sp3_gdr.090206-1234

Tudom a works4meval nem sokra mész, de ezt a technikát én nem fogom egyhamar használni, ezért nem kezdek debuggolásba.

Köszönöm Udi. Így már működik, csak egyetlen aprócska gondom van még vele. Az ékezetes betűk eltűnnek, normál windows alatt meg látom őket. Meg ha flash szerkesztőbe írok vele. Erre van ötleted?
Köszönöm még egyszer a helpet!

http://www.tranceislands.hu
http://georgemichael.weboldala.net

A generáló oldalon van egy ilyen rész, hogy: "Include the following glyphs (if available)", ott be kell kattintanod azokat a karaktereket, amikre szükséged lehet. A legegyszerűbb az All bekattintása, és akkor úgy ahogy van az összes karaktert konvertálja. A magyar ékezetek a Latin Extended A-ba esnek bele, ha csak az kell, akkor elég lehet az is. De azt nézd meg, hogy a Chillerben benne van-e az Ű és Ő, mert amit én leszedtem, abban nincs benne (általában ez a kettő marad ki, mert a double acute accent ritka).

Ez egy őskövület megoldás még abból az indőből, mikor volt érdemben Netscape :) Én annak idején sokat használtam, mostanában már nem. A Weft-es rész használható belőle szerintem:
http://www.vhf.hu/tatrai/tutorials/dynfonts/dynfont.html

Ennek van jelenleg is létező verziója, ez Explorer alatt megy rendesen:
http://www.microsoft.com/typography/web/embedding/weft/

eFeS
http://infoblog.tatrai.hu

En is a kepes megoldasra buzditanalak. Ha ilyesmire van szukseg tomegesen, valtozo szovegen (tehat nem statikus szovegu fejleceknel, hanem valtozo szovegezesu helyeken) akkor az oldalterv rossz, tessek visszadobni ujraterveztetesre.
--


()=() Ki oda vagyik,
('Y') hol szall a galamb
C . C elszalasztja a
()_() kincset itt alant.